WebAug 21, 2024 · Least Square Method. Least Square Method (LSM) is a mathematical procedure for finding the curve of best fit to a given set of data points, such that,the sum of the squares of residuals is minimum. Residual is the difference between observed and estimated values of dependent variable. Method of Least Squares can be used for …
